A New Benchmark for Mission-Critical Autonomy

As showcased in this system is engineered from the ground up for next-generation drone autonomy. The KAI framework features a sophisticated dual-layer architecture. It isolates high-performance AI processing from a deterministic, safety-critical flight control layer. This design allows the system to manage complex intelligence without risking flight stability.

The core capabilities making this autopilot a game-changer include:

  • Kinetic with AI: Leveraging an embedded neural engine, the KAI processes real-time computer vision tasks, object detection, and visual tracking directly on the device.

  • Beyond GNSS Navigation: When satellite signals are lost, jammed, or spoofed, the autopilot utilizes terrain matching and visual SLAM (Simultaneous Localization and Mapping) to maintain absolute positioning drift-free.

  • Advanced SWARM Capabilities: Built on a scalable architecture, it supports synchronized multi-vehicle operations through a shared data-link network, enabling highly coordinated saturation missions or wide-area surveillance.

  • Aviation-Grade Reliability: For absolute mission assurance, the core flight stack is strictly compliant with DO-178C and DO-254 aviation safety standards, delivering redundant, high-integrity computing under extreme conditions.
